option A is the correct answer.Muscle ccontraction is the process of activation of tension generating sites within muscle fibres.The motion of the muscle shortens as the myosin heads bind to actin and pull the actin inwards.As the actin is pulled toward the M line ,the sarcomere shortens and the muscle contracts.ATP can then attach to myosin,which allows the cross bridge cycle to start again and further muscle contraction can occur.A sarcomere is defined as the distance between two consecutive Z lines,when muscle contracts ,the distance between the Z lines is reduced only.During muscle contraction ,the distance between Z lines never increases and the sarcomere never elongates,it only shortens.The globular heads of the myosin bind actin and forms cross bridges between the thick and thin filaments.This movement slides the actin filaments from both sides of the sarcomere towards the M line,which causes the shortening of the sarcomere and results in muscle contraction.During muscle contraction actin gets pulled along myosin,not myosin gets pulled towards actin,and it is towards the centre of the sarcomere until the actin and myosin filaments gets completely overlapped.And they slide by one another,sarcomere shortens but the filaments remains the same length.
